Introduction Studies have addressed the issue of increasing prevalence of work-related musculoskeletal (MSK) pain among different occupations. However, contributing factors to MSK pain have not been fully investigated among orthopaedic surgeons. Thus, this study aimed to approximate the prevalence and predictors of MSK pain among Saudi orthopaedic surgeons working in Riyadh, Saudi Arabia. Methods A cross-sectional study using an electronic survey was conducted in Riyadh. The questionnaire was distributed through email among orthopaedic surgeons in Riyadh hospitals. Standardized Nordic questionnaires for the analysis of musculoskeletal symptoms were used. Descriptive measures for categorical and numerical variables were presented. Student’s t-test and Pearson’s χ2 test were used. The level of statistical significance was set at p ≤ 0.05. Results The response rate was 80.3%, with a total number of 179 of Saudi orthopaedic surgeons (173 males and six females). Of our sample, 67.0% of the respondents complained of having MSK pain. The most commonly reported MSK pain was lower back (74.0%), followed by neck (58.2%). Age and body mass index were implicated in the development of more than one type of MSK pain. Increased years of experience (≥ 6 years) was linked to shoulder/elbow, lower back, and hip/thigh pain. Smoking is widely associated with lower back pain development, whereas physicians who do not smoke and exercise regularly reported fewer pain incidences. Excessive bending and twisting during daily practice have been correlated with increased neck pain. Conclusion MSK pain was found to be common among Saudi orthopaedic surgeons. Further extensive research should be conducted to understand and analyze the risk factors involved and search for possible improvements to avoid further complications. However, ergonomics education during surgical training could be effective at modifying behaviors and reducing MSK pain manifestations.

Purpose—This study aimed to estimate the prevalence and risk factors of MSD pain in various anatomical regions among nurses. Method—A cross-sectional study involving a self-administered questionnaire by registered nurses with clinical experience. Data was collected using convenience sampling after obtaining informed consent. The results were drawn from a total of 300 nurses. Results—The nurses presented with occasional mental exhaustion (44.3%) and often physical exhaustion (44.0%). Almost all (97.3%) the nurses complained of having work-related pain during the last 12 months. Body parts with the most pain were the lower back (86.7%), ankles (86.7%), neck (86.0%), shoulders (85.0%), lower legs (84.7%) and upper back (84.3%). The pain frequency was rated as occasional pain for the neck and upper back, pain was often felt for the rest of the parts. Nurses complained of severe pain in the lower back (19.7%), right shoulder (29.7%) and left shoulder (30.3%). The frequency of having musculoskeletal symptoms in any body region was increased with age, lower education level, female gender, high BMI, job tenure and lifestyle. Conclusions—Nurses’ WRMSD complaints should be taken seriously to curb further risk and musculoskeletal hazards.

ObjectiveTo compare the prevalence of work-related potential traumatic events (PTEs), support protocols and mental health symptoms across Dutch gynaecologists, orthopaedic surgeons and paediatricians.DesignCross-sectional study, supplementary analysis of combined data.SettingNationwide survey between 2014 and 2017.ParticipantsAn online questionnaire was sent to all Dutch gynaecologists, orthopaedic surgeons and paediatricians, including resident physicians (4959 physicians). 1374 questionnaires were eligible for analysis, corresponding with a response rate of 27.7%.Outcome measuresPrimary outcome measures were the prevalence of work-related PTEs, depression, anxiety, psychological distress and traumatic stress, measured with validated screening instruments (Hospital Anxiety and Depression Scale, Trauma Screening Questionnaire). Secondary outcomes were the association of mental health and defensive practice to traumatic events and support protocols.ResultsOf the respondents, 20.8% experienced a work-related PTE at least 4 weeks ago. Prevalence rates indicative of depression, anxiety or post-traumatic stress disorder (PTSD) were 6.4%, 13.6% and 1.5%, respectively. Depression (9.2% vs 5.2%, p=0.019), anxiety (18.2% vs 8.2%, p<0.001) and psychological distress (22.8% vs 12.5%, p<0.001) were significantly more prevalent in female compared with male attendings. The absence of a support protocol was significantly associated with more probable PTSD (p=0.022). Those who witnessed a PTE, reported more defensive work changes (28.0% vs 20.5%, p=0.007) and those with probable PTSD considered to quit medical work more often (60.0% vs 35.8%, p=0.032).ConclusionPhysicians are frequently exposed to PTEs with high emotional impact over the course of their career. Lacking a support protocol after adverse events was associated with more post-traumatic stress. Adverse events were associated with considering to quit medical practice and a more defensive practice. More awareness must be created for the mental health of physicians as well as for the implementation of a well-organised support system after PTEs.

Background: Dental specialists are at a higher risk of work related musculoskeletal disorders (WMSD) that lead to physical disability. Musculoskeletal pain in dentists is due to constrained body postures for prolonged period of time. Limited number of studies has been done in India to check the prevalence and factors associated with the musculoskeletal pain among dentists. Purpose: To see the prevalence and assess the intensity of musculoskeletal pain in different anatomical parts among dentists from two different institutes of Chandigarh along with identification of selected factors associated with the onset of musculoskeletal (MS) pain among them. Methods: A cross-sectional study was made among interns, postgraduate students and faculty members from two different institutes of Chandigarh. A total of 120 members completed a questionnaire containing 24 questions. The study variables in the questionnaire were divided into 3 groups as: Socio-demographic information, ergonomic variables and work- related musculoskeletal pain. Results: Most of the dentists (79.2%) reported musculoskeletal pain during the past 12 months. On comparing different locations of pain, the lower back region was frequently affected area (87.4%) followed by pain in neck region (83.2%). Females were more susceptible to pain than males. A significant association (p<0.05) was found between sitting posture adopted by dentists, years of practice and the MS pain. Highest prevalence was found in dentists adopting forward bent posture in sitting during work (87.3%) and those working for >15 years (90.9%). Conclusion: The study revealed that prevalence of musculoskeletal pain was high among dentists. Higher incidence of pain was found in women and younger dentists. The lower back region was most commonly affected area followed by neck region. The study also found that musculoskeletal pain increased with increase in years of practice with significant association between them. Musculoskeletal symptoms are the most frequent occupational health problems and accounts for a large number of losses in working days and disability for workers in modern industrialization. The aim of this paper was to investigate the relationship between the self-reported prevalence of musculoskeletal symptoms in the head/neck, upper back and lower back and certain individual, work- related physical, psychological and general health factors. A cross-sectional study was conducted using a descriptive questionnaire which was distributed to 350 oil refinery workers in Iran and collected between April to December 2016. A total of 282 workers returned completed questionnaire, yielding a response rate of 81%. For the head/neck region, working at the long periods in uncomfortable posture (adjusted [Formula: see text], 95% [Formula: see text]–2.58) and doing repetitive activity (adjusted [Formula: see text], 95% [Formula: see text]–2.67) increased the risk experiencing head/neck symptoms. For the upper back region, lifting and transferring during work increased the risk of experiencing upper back symptoms (adjusted [Formula: see text], 95% [Formula: see text]–2.79). For the lower back region, working for more than 8[Formula: see text]h a week shows the strongly significant association for the risk of lower back symptoms. Lower back pain was associated with symptoms of anxiety and dysfunction in social functioning. Some physical and psychological factors were associated with the prevalence of musculoskeletal symptoms in the spine among oil refinery workers. These data emphasize the need to develop and implement preventive measures that reduce the prevalence of musculoskeletal symptoms among workers.

Objective: To determine the prevalence of musculoskeletal disorders in dentists who attend postgraduate courses in various specialties and establish possible relationships with sociodemographic and occupational factors. Methodology: This is a cross-sectional study where 91 professionals responded to validated instruments: “Work-related activities that may contribute to job-related pain and / or injury” and NMQ “Nordic Musculoskeletal Questionnaire”, and variables were also collected regarding sociodemographic and occupational characteristics. Results: WMSDs were often reported in the neck, shoulder, lower/upper back, and hand/wrists. Logistic regression analysis revealed that there was a correlation between reports of WMSD in lower back and work related (OR=13.40). Moreover, associations were found between WMSDs and the occupational factors that can contribute to musculoskeletal disorders. Conclusion: There was a high prevalence of musculoskeletal disorders among brazilian dentists, and that the work-related activities contributed to musculoskeletal disorders in dentists.
